Benjamin Moore-impressed ice cream paints its way into Ace Hardware
For Countrywide Ice Product Day, brand names have rolled out flavors ranging from Kraft Macaroni and Cheese to pizza-encouraged scoops. But not likely ice cream purveyor Ace Hardware has a new twist on the frozen deal with for the duration of the commemorative day this yr: pints motivated by Benjamin Moore paint cans.
The world’s major retailer-owned components cooperative has jumped into Nationwide Ice Product Day on July 17 with a house advancement (and ice product) influenced promotion. Since individuals have a tendency to say they’ll get to home advancement projects “someday,” Ace Components is declaring July 16 “Some Working day.”
People today who fill out an online questionnaire about their dwelling enhancement ideas will enter a drawing to acquire a free pint of paint-motivated ice cream. There will be a questionnaire in an Instagram tale on July 17 to give persons in New York, Chicago and Los Angeles a likelihood to gain a paint-motivated ice product reward. An Ace Components ice product truck serving paint-inspired treats will appear to a surprise locale on July 17.
And, certainly, the ice cream is definitely inspired by the paint. Built by a non-public label manufacturer for Ace Hardware, the 4 flavors of ice product have pint containers that glimpse like paint cans and are flavors that match hues of Benjamin Moore paint — French White, Mint Chocolate Chip, Strawberry-n-Product and Cocoa Brown.
It’s not uncommon for paint to be influenced by and named after food stuff. Paint shades have a wide range of evocative names, which companies have explained are intended to spark thoughts, emotions and needs in the folks who might choose them. Immediate-to-buyer paint organization Backdrop co-founder Natalie Ebel told the Linked Push in 2020 that picking out the correct names for paint hues is essential.
“Each title was preferred to evoke an emotional link we were being motivated by genuine persons, spots, points and moods,” she claimed.
But how often do these evocatively named hues get built into food? It is possibly a quite exceptional prevalence, taking into consideration portray and snacking generally do not combine. Then again, how often do folks go to a components retail outlet on the lookout for ice cream? Ace Hardware has primarily answered this dilemma: It’s the form of issue that takes place “Some Working day.”

Fyxx Wellness can take a bite of snack space with vitamin cookies
Fyxx Well being is aiming to upend the $43 billion snacking class by introducing what it promises is the to start with of its sort: a lower-sugar, very low-carb vitamin cookie.
The take care of involves several of the nutritional vitamins and minerals that several people uncover them selves lacking right now, which includes vitamin D, vitamin B12, calcium, magnesium and zinc, the corporation mentioned. The new cookie enhances other goods from Fyxx with varying needs, like heart-balanced cookies, immune-boosting drink products and solutions, power-improving espresso powders and candies manufactured from carrots.
“We feel in placing the very good things in the fun things. We take out the guilt and include the goodness,” Sung Park, Fyxx Health’s founder and CEO, claimed in a statement. “Even the healthiest and effectively-intentioned amid us have earned a address, and what is better than a wholesome cookie masquerading as a naughty one?”
Fyxx was established by Park in 2019 following emergency open heart operation forced him to handle his personal diet regime and way of life. The mission, in accordance to the corporation, is to make nutritious ingesting less complicated and available as a result of enjoyable and common food items.
As consumers look to stability their urge to snack with an at any time-rising need to take in more healthy, cookies like these loaded with natural vitamins could be primed to capture a larger sized share of the burgeoning market.
The worldwide balanced treats marketplace is predicted to arrive at $152.5 billion by 2030 with a compound annual expansion amount of 6.6{680c5f9cb46a7a54731929069920ce17b7cd4b3b32dcb36e8e9c5cdd0d2a610c}, according to a report by Grand See Study. The food stuff marketplace has benefited from developing customer desire in dietary treats higher in natural vitamins and proteins and lower in calories, the organization famous.
But even with the opportunity, Fyxx finds alone heading up in opposition to other field upstarts and heavyweights that are introducing their have better-for-you treats.
Mondelēz Intercontinental, for case in point, invested in 2019 in Uplift Food items, a startup establishing prebiotic meals with a line of Gut Joyful Cookies. Nightfood just lately introduced the launch of cookies with much less sugar, unwanted fat and calories as nicely as 200{680c5f9cb46a7a54731929069920ce17b7cd4b3b32dcb36e8e9c5cdd0d2a610c} additional protein and 500{680c5f9cb46a7a54731929069920ce17b7cd4b3b32dcb36e8e9c5cdd0d2a610c} a lot more fiber than other cookie brand names, the company reported. And Hostess, finest known for Twinkies and Donettes, procured Voortman, a manufacturer of quality, branded wafers and sugar-no cost and specialty cookies in 2020.

Circulation follows performance craze
To go with the movement, or to enter a new category? That is the problem.
Flow Beverage, which sells alkaline drinking water in 100{680c5f9cb46a7a54731929069920ce17b7cd4b3b32dcb36e8e9c5cdd0d2a610c} recyclable Tetra Pak cartons, is launching Move Vitamin-Infused Drinking water in 3 flavors: Cherry, Citrus and Elderberry. The company released the products in Fred Meyer’s grocery merchants, and explained it will be readily available direct-to-purchaser on its site.
The Canada-dependent firm claimed in its push launch that the improved-for-you facets of its useful h2o make it stand out in opposition to other drinks in the class. Movement pointed especially to the drinks that contains 120{680c5f9cb46a7a54731929069920ce17b7cd4b3b32dcb36e8e9c5cdd0d2a610c} of the advised every day total of vitamin C and staying a solid supply of zinc. It also has zero sugar, calories or preservatives, and is designed with natural licensed substances.
Sales of Flow’s solutions soared in 2021, and its drinking water is now accessible in much more than 35,600 stores in North The usa. Flow’s founder and latest CEO, Nicholas Reichenbach, stated in a press release that the enterprise getting into purposeful beverages is a purely natural progression for the brand name.
“The functional drinking water market is escalating rapidly as purchaser[s] find more healthy possibilities,” Reichenbach claimed. We believe that Stream has innovated a products that fits squarely into shopper desires and complements our current portfolio of sustainable and practical beverages.”
The functional water group has expanded significantly in the latest decades, and is projected to be worthy of $5.8 billion by 2025, according to Technavio. There are quite a few startup manufacturers in the house, including Karma, which debuted a line of CBD-infused functional drinking water distributed by Constellation Manufacturers previous slide. Flow’s new beverage line also will be competing against drinks like Coca-Cola’s Vitamin Drinking water and the Anheuser-Busch-distributed ShineWater, but could garner an edge with sustainability-minded buyers.
